Output c875279eabfa33bdfad3541309c44697079de576f6004fa0c8a7a5ee1a7d12f5:39

value
36988610
script pubkey
OP_0 OP_PUSHBYTES_20 25ff57189d2089a453f82018f3a8c679c48c9f25
address
bc1qyhl4wxyayzy6g5lcyqv082xx08zge8e9w7kjpl
transaction
c875279eabfa33bdfad3541309c44697079de576f6004fa0c8a7a5ee1a7d12f5
confirmations
1022
spent
true